Moon Garden: A sweet spot in Valencia

The Moon Garden Cafe is a hidden gem tucked away in the lush mountains of Valencia, Negros Oriental. It is not a typical bustling cafe but rather a tranquil and rustic escape that offers a unique and intimate dining experience surrounded by nature. The charm of Moon Garden lies in its simplicity, its breathtaking mountain views, and the sense of peace it provides to those who seek a brief respite from the fast-paced city life of Dumaguete. Aloguinsan’s Bojo River Cruise: An eco-friendly journey to discovery

The Bojo River Cruise in Aloguinsan, Cebu, is a captivating eco-cultural tour that has earned international recognition as a sustainable tourism destination. It offers a unique blend of natural beauty, environmental education, and authentic community engagement. Unlike commercialized attractions, the Bojo River experience is managed by the local community, which ensures its preservation and provides a genuine glimpse into the lives and traditions of the people who call this place home. Cebu Safari Travel Guide: Experience the wild

A full day at the Cebu Safari and Adventure Park is an immersive and exhilarating experience that transports visitors from the bustling city of Cebu into a sprawling, lush landscape reminiscent of an African savannah. Located in the mountainous terrain of Carmen, this world-class destination is more than just a zoo; it’s a meticulously designed park spanning over 170 hectares, home to over 1,000 animals from more than 120 species. A Day Trek Guide to Mount Ulap, Benguet: An Itinerary of Clouds and Cordillera Ridges

Mount Ulap, a crown jewel of Itogon, Benguet, offers a quintessential day trek experience for both a seasoned mountaineer and a first-time hiker. It is a 9.4-kilometer eco-trail that has captivated the hearts of many with its stunning natural features, from rolling pine-covered ridges to panoramic views of the Cordillera mountain range. A day spent traversing this trail is an immersion into the cool, misty air of the mountains, a physical challenge with a rewarding payoff, and a chance to capture some of the most iconic landscapes in the Philippines. Cebu Travel Guide: A Vibrant Blend of History, Culture, and Natural Beauty

Cebu City, often hailed as the “Queen City of the South,” is the Philippines’ oldest city and a captivating destination that seamlessly blends historical charm with modern vibrancy. From ancient churches and colonial landmarks to stunning natural wonders and delectable cuisine, Cebu offers a rich tapestry of experiences for every traveler. It is the capital of the province of the same name, so it also serves a transport hub, connection you to any cities, municipalities, and islands within and around Cebu province.
